Delaney Bramlett, 69, a singer, songwriter and producer who penned classic rock songs such as "Let It Rain" and worked with musicians George Harrison and Eric Clapton, died Saturday at UCLA Ronald Reagan Medical Center in Los Angeles as a result of complications from gallbladder surgery, his wife Susan Lanier-Bramlett said...

By Adam Raymond Misspelling album titles is one of the grandest traditions in music. From The Zombies’ Odessey and Oracle released in 1968 to Ghostface Killah’s The Big Doe Rehab released in 2007, misspelling titles, intentionally or not, transcends time and genre.
